Bill Summary

For legislation to develop an elective high school course on labor law and workers’ rights. Education.

AI Summary

This bill mandates the development of a new elective high school course focused on labor law and workers' rights, with the curriculum to be created by the Department of Elementary and Secondary Education and the Executive Office of Education, in consultation with a youth advisory committee, by May 1, 2014. The bill also requires a pilot program for this course to begin by the 2014-2015 academic year, followed by full implementation as a high school elective no later than the start of the 2016-2017 academic year, ensuring students gain knowledge about their rights as workers.
